Let f(x) be y.

y  = x³ + 3

Switch x and y:

x = y³ + 3

Now you need to isolate y and you would get inverse function.

x - 3 = y³

∛(x-3) = y

Final answer: f ⁻¹(x) = ∛(x-3)
